US Rail Intermodal Volume Surges While Network Speeds Decline

US intermodal rail volume jumped 10% last week, but major railroads face significant network congestion and speed deterioration.

According to FreightWaves, US intermodal rail volume experienced a robust 10% increase last week, extending a strong growth trajectory for the sector. The surge in freight movement reflects continued demand for rail transportation across major corridors, signaling ongoing strength in domestic logistics networks.

The volume expansion, however, comes at a cost: major railroads are reporting significant network slowdowns and speed reductions. Some carriers have experienced train speeds decline to 10-to-20 month lows, indicating that rail infrastructure is struggling to accommodate the heightened traffic volumes without operational degradation.

The contrast extends beyond US borders. Canadian intermodal volumes are declining during the same period, creating a divergence in North American rail performance that underscores differing demand pressures between the two countries. The combination of rising US volumes and slower transit times may prompt industry stakeholders to reassess capacity and operational efficiency strategies.
